Q: GateTally turnstile counter at Ferrow Stadium shows zero after a power blip — what now?
A: Counts are safe in the sealed buffer. Restart the aggregator, then unseal the buffer from the kiosk console. It will prompt once. Enter the recovery passphrase shown below.

unlock words, kawig-bawef: belax-sorir-druax-ulaiel-wenael-belael

Management Meeting Minutes — Regional Sales Review

Attendees: sales leads, regional directors, one rep from Norlund Distribution.

Quick recap: the eastern region beat target again, mostly on the Quillard range, while the southern branches slipped about 6% — blamed on delayed stock from the Hartenby depot. Agreed actions: rebalance inventory by mid-month, pair underperforming branches with eastern mentors, and revisit incentive tiers next quarter. Good energy overall, but let's not coast. The confidential note on upcoming plans follows below.

internal memo for hahif-hahaf: Headcount on the Zorwyn team goes from 9 to 100 by the end of October. Gross margin on Zorwyn came in at 5 percent against a plan of 10 percent.

**Break-Glass: Pebblekiln Hermetic Migration**

So, we're mid-migration from the old Makera scripts to the hermetic Stoneforge build system, and occasionally the sealed toolchain cache locks itself during a failed sync. If that blocks a security-critical rebuild, break-glass access lets a reviewer force-unseal the cache. Use sparingly — everything gets logged and flagged for the weekly audit. To unseal, the console prompts once, and you enter the recovery passphrase listed right below.

vault phrase of bagaf-kajeg = jorath-feniel-briir-siliel-ralix

## Local Setup — Incremental Rebuilds

The Fernlight site generator rebuilds only pages whose source hashes changed since the last run. For local testing, clone the repo, install dependencies with the bundled script, and run the watcher in dev mode. Hash state is kept in a small tracking database so partial builds survive restarts. Before triggering your first incremental build, point the watcher at the tracking database using the connection string below.

primary connection of tajeg-tajop = postgresql://julax_svc:DI@db-e7f3.kelvidyn.corp:5432/rusdor